设为首页

广西经贸职业技术学院论坛

 忘记密码
 免费注册
查看: 2142|回复: 0
打印 上一主题 下一主题

[建站技术]实用:网页制作中常用的辅助代码

[复制链接]
  • TA的每日心情

    2019-8-18 09:37
  • 签到天数: 2 天

    [LV.1]初来乍到

    跳转到指定楼层
    楼主
    发表于 2009-10-16 01:17:14 | 只看该作者 回帖奖励 |正序浏览 |阅读模式
    点击返回上页代码: : b$ j9 ?: o0 [5 g- }: t
    <form>
    ) w7 T8 Y& U& J; R. E<p><input TYPE="button" VALUE="返回上一步"></p>
    , [! f7 I: S# u0 Z</form> $ ^5 U: h  y9 V# M: p: U/ O7 O- ?

    % u, Z0 H* l6 |9 `弹出警告框代码:
    6 t& |+ T4 c3 h! n) F% a<form>
    0 a( `8 N# z& t% n<p><input TYPE="button" VALUE="弹出警告框"></p>
    3 w! J" h/ X, f3 F</form> ' V" D# w8 D) P5 H( H3 }
    <script language="JavaScript"><!-- # S  j# K' G5 O$ P
    function AlertButton(){window.alert("要多多光临呀!");} # G- H; o+ I2 \. l# z
    // --></script> ' X  _5 w4 i7 z. Q0 F
    % ]  c- p/ n* K3 ]7 O
    点击打开新窗口
    ! i8 V' |! T8 k, d7 X<form>
    & v8 A7 {5 Z. u3 ?# q# M. M<p><input TYPE="button" VALUE="打开新窗口"></p> 8 V8 K5 R! C5 @! h  z! A
    </form> 0 F5 y: v. @: D& J4 f+ B
    <script language="JavaScript"><!-- ( z# y  p% v1 G+ q( e. n/ m2 ^
    function NewWindow(){window.open("http://www.mcmx.com","","height=240,width=340,status=no,location=no,
    4 t# h' U# A/ D' Z; t: stoolbar=no,directories=no,menubar=no");} ; Y4 f& A$ U: p0 m* h: u7 {
    // --></script></body>
    7 O; q9 G6 f# d1 s! n8 X5 z7 Y
    : E/ l) e% z3 @" _! O$ ?删除记录时弹出确认框: 9 _# G6 \7 k( `; ?2 Q/ W
    <script LANGUAGE="VBSCRIPT"> 4 o! @7 J' v, w4 l+ ^9 ^9 @4 m
    a=msgbox("真的要删除该记录吗?",1,"注意")
    # E7 V1 E: I: l. Bif a=1 then 9 }, B) t3 C6 p+ U% ^
    location="Dodelete.asp?id=" //指向执行删除的页面Dodelete.asp / j9 m; Z1 g7 U7 d3 P8 M
    else
    $ H, `; K$ F, C1 o) l* |# Khistory.go(-1)
    0 g. X* S" L; H6 r: F( }end if 8 w' C. e- E# o
    </script>
    0 o4 J' g; x+ v: F9 r0 Z
    ; ^9 o  Q4 |* a关闭打开的窗口 * I! |* n$ X5 C& N
    < a href="/">关闭窗口</a>
      d& O* u" z( b( R0 S+ e) T# |5 X8 P* u8 y
    清空INPUT且选定
    7 c5 a) [% d' W" _! WonClick="Javascript:this.value=''" , H& S( \- D, v
    - q$ g+ t$ C5 X5 N" B3 F
    右键屏蔽 # e5 p. u4 F: `' w% c- H
    <body oncontextmenu=self.event.returnValue=false> % L* k$ i" x" x  A3 }. O6 J

    2 C  k6 ^( F. K$ w! Z& T连串英文自动换行的解决方法 IE5.5 9 U9 G, R( r$ R! z, ]  J& Q( j
    style="LEFT: 0px; WIDTH: 100%; WORD-WRAP: break-word" 你可修改为指定的大小如 200px 6 v2 J9 a9 t/ ^, s
    " m5 t( G, G6 \  `1 u0 t/ B* y4 W
    图片“重置”按钮 4 K: I# \( w* S+ h+ u" N2 f
    <script language="jscript">
    * _7 c, W& X9 c. ?- qfunction myreset() . }4 H) P1 ?: ]
    { document.login.reset();
    % j4 a  [' `2 I( sdocument.login.focus();}
    , k6 ~4 S. @' {9 \2 A/ U" ^</script> ( h( Z* r/ z- W/ @+ `9 h( X1 u
    <img src="image/reclear.gif" width="69" height="20" style="cursor:hand"
    8 L% b$ o, j) G0 e0 F* p' b# w3 V3 X( C) e. ]& m- F6 R' _$ ~9 i9 g
    画细线表格
    7 ?9 w3 }: t6 ?3 ]! a0 Z<table style="border-collapse: collapse"> / @3 `* t3 a7 n* v$ H

    2 k5 b2 H; A2 @6 F状态栏信息
      {) p; a4 Q" o8 g; A<form> ! m8 W6 ^; N" e9 Y
    <p><input TYPE="button" VALUE="状态栏信息"></p>   i$ n( x# \3 B" u% T  ]; |' V+ m7 x
    </form>
      J& E3 Y! g0 X! n( Z; F, @<script language="JavaScript"><!-- 9 U8 r3 d8 u& l) d4 k% {# O
    function StatusButton(){window.status="要多多光临呀!";}
    / X$ S/ j. I$ g5 d9 r; i, K// --></script> 1 b' _; o- }# U9 W8 ^
    2 o/ c8 r# i3 U$ j* o, Q1 \
    最小化、最大化、关闭窗口 % g1 l# E0 n. @$ C
    <object id=hh1 classid="clsid:ADB880A6-D8FF-11CF-9377-00AA003B7A11"> 2 a9 G, t1 K: p  z
    <param name="Command" value="Minimize"></object>
    : M* K' s# \- ?. U! t* K. n6 o<object id=hh2 classid="clsid:ADB880A6-D8FF-11CF-9377-00AA003B7A11"> ; u) X6 ?; R" v
    <param name="Command" value="Maximize"></object> + F5 J7 \/ h& Q) `
    <OBJECT id=hh3 classid="clsid:adb880a6-d8ff-11cf-9377-00aa003b7a11">
    9 [2 T, T: s" R<PARAM NAME="Command" VALUE="Close"></OBJECT>
    0 x  f! I; B6 f5 @/ B- k+ A2 T* W6 E; R. x7 C1 A9 [( ]3 W3 p8 G
    <input type=button value=最小化 onclick=hh1.Click()> ! p0 `; J8 Z  N+ D+ u2 [! d9 ], d* i
    <input type=button value=最大化 onclick=hh2.Click()> : e# v2 L- X/ R; l
    <input type=button value=关闭 onclick=hh3.Click()>
    % h% _5 ~5 L9 a' F本例适用于IE , ]) ~. N1 q; v! j0 P. w
    7 q8 m- a' T# ^, G: T
    隐藏状态栏里出现的LINK信息
    ! t5 x# D7 I7 E  F<a href="http://";>梦想天空</a> + V' z1 n* c! C% X) \+ N

    ( u+ ]3 U0 X; w0 C& F% d4 w$ a8 Q文本框自动滚动条
    - l; i$ B3 j2 r: @/ _2 a9 B- P<textarea name=words rows=18 cols=26 style="border:1 solid #000000;background-color:white; font-size:9pt; width:188; overflow:auto" wrap=hard></textarea>
    - F6 A3 W$ k5 r
    2 {2 r) c3 }0 g全选并复制
    3 U: x  X4 z- l$ P3 W# g' b. Q<FORM name=test><INPUT type=button value=全选并复制><BR><TEXTAREA name=select1 rows=3 cols=46>你好,欢迎您的光临!</TEXTAREA>
    6 G& c# ^8 c/ b' n" R</FORM> 7 o4 f- T& Q' R% N" z- `
    <SCRIPT language=Javascript>
    1 o# P- r# Q1 A3 c" I0 ~! P<!-- ; Q6 o, V9 s* k7 _

    7 R. ?1 x9 `  s; Lvar copytoclip=1 2 u$ L2 N0 [# _: w1 l  u5 _

    $ k: v1 ^  S7 B+ p8 @' M& z8 Yfunction HighlightAll(theField) { % ]2 t- _' e+ n& \$ \
    var tempval=eval("document."+theField)
    ( S% `4 t# h6 I0 W7 @4 F" |, ~# wtempval.focus() 7 c2 o1 T4 u0 J. z+ n7 x  g" C
    tempval.select()
    % r4 X; t6 d: ]( Eif (document.all&©toclip==1){
    - u0 g. Z9 T% c1 I% M3 ttherange=tempval.createTextRange() 4 c6 P3 ?3 ?& G  o  Q  q" H  j9 F
    therange.execCommand("Copy") ! w! L0 o  o  V; F5 G
    window.status="Contents highlighted and copied to clipboard!"
    6 o# g1 y* f! A) v( E, A  \  }+ a8 msetTimeout("window.status=''",1800)
    7 K, y7 g5 W* [" Z} : [6 M% X: Y- D- X: A) F) V
    } 9 Q5 B; E2 R% W- D
    //--> 8 _! K) ?) ]# J. T/ [
    </SCRIPT>
    8 s9 ?; M6 Y  q5 Q; {/ i  t
    * s, R7 o9 S/ U# T: {1 |$ M屏蔽JAVASCRIPT错误
    - P" ]4 ?7 [# ]9 b1 T& T<script language="JavaScript"> . O* h5 t3 f9 ?4 j. i& T
    <!-- 5 ]1 x: Z' B9 j* L# h3 ~" N4 R4 K
    function killErrors(){ 0 b4 E( e0 f3 ^" N8 M7 Q7 z
    return true;
    3 C  U( o* b+ p3 L3 b}
    0 l2 Q. D1 Q* L2 jwindow.onerror = killErrors; ! K9 ]$ ?6 C, H1 I
    --> " m' [8 N# y9 M' `! K: C
    </script> - i) Y  p% q, h; y
    0 w  z# @' Q* \
    关闭子窗口时刷新父窗口 ! Y# r- G  y& n+ J# Q% j+ c' G8 ~) j: d
    <script language="JavaScript">
    - r9 ?% j- D, |/ X/ ^<!--
    % o6 O- }6 x5 ?, b/ Xself.opener.location.reload();
    / W; ]+ x  _- Ewindow.close() ( A) x: j; g/ ]9 C  A9 x7 j
    -->
    : h- [0 G7 C  Q7 p" {4 [% Z</script> + [# [0 ]6 M; t

    + K0 @4 A4 ~7 e! a0 K0 D4 A1 T4 \' `7 a+ r& u
    背景色变换 ( {, f, g0 |( h0 @; g
    <form>
    9 O, D. k( r  s: P$ j) _: E. ~5 Q<p><input TYPE="button" VALUE="背景色变换"></p> : a) v! a" n7 m
    </form>
    3 @0 f$ ^; F9 e9 C<script>function BgButton(){ 2 V8 F. ~+ y# A: Y/ j
    if (document.bgColor=='#00ffff')
    , e+ J3 P& ?' i  K$ Q. J, |2 q{document.bgColor='#ffffff';}
    & n* Y! f; k+ N; eelse{document.bgColor='#00ffff';}
    3 p8 G' h- ?' T4 l}
    6 Q& S3 [' f' R# k4 P9 H& l</script> / s; G8 l9 Z1 z- Y

    , \& x- Q# U+ E( W( p, z检查一段字符串是否全由数字组成
    ' q; Y% q9 R$ Q8 {" ~0 b8 p* G1 K<script language="Javascript"><!--
    & i+ O0 ?+ d$ Yfunction checkNum(str){return str.match(//D/)==null}
    5 m& D3 \$ A( z  s* u0 E  p4 ualert(checkNum("1232142141")) % f6 }* U% E2 |3 |# U
    alert(checkNum("123214214a1")) 6 r* K4 `6 X  t# S3 x3 f
    // --></script>
    $ P) g. @, n4 X$ h/ `( q
    4 r! ?3 f3 T. L" b& s判断是否是字符 ! Q3 h9 s$ @( K/ c: n& i
    if (/[^/x00-/xff]/g.test(s)) alert("含有汉字");
    ; M+ i- b1 c1 N2 P) L- L
      j2 z7 w& x3 j2 ~; N( v1 \点击刷新代码: , t( \" D) |+ D9 ^: {/ G, ~/ P/ r
    <form>   V" Z4 K& ^3 a4 c0 u2 i
    <p><input TYPE="button" VALUE="刷新按钮一"></p>
    & C; i; @; `- M  ^% i" ]4 [</form>
    4 r2 s- R9 i; Y4 k<script language="JavaScript"><!-- ) B! t5 D# y9 H
    function ReloadButton(){location.href="allbutton.htm";}
    + ^+ c; i2 y; u8 S4 K  ?// --></script> " @1 w0 f. D* U/ T0 W

    * r% Z4 u. S  c; |& ?# l+ j: B让层不被控件复盖代码: + m- V  s8 z' Q9 r
    <div z-Index:2><object xxx></object></div> # 前面
    $ b$ q5 W& `0 \<div z-Index:1><object xxx></object></div> # 后面
    6 o& v0 T3 l; t<div id="Layer2" style="position:absolute; top:40;width:400px; height:95px;z-index:2"><table height=100% width=100% bgcolor="#ff0000"><tr><td height=100% width=100%></td></tr></table><iframe width=0 height=0></iframe></div>
    * q  h, F* Y6 t" i4 ?& @, a<div id="Layer1" style="position:absolute; top:50;width:200px; height:115px;z-index:1"><iframe height=100% width=100%></iframe></div>
    7 X5 ?+ d9 P5 B7 c- d! M: |1 v, z0 D# J( a% C' w
    让层的相对定位 % A" t- s  _  ?  e
    <div id="Layer1" style="position:relative; left:0px; top:0px; width:0px; height:0px;z-index:1">
    3 ^% Y4 }8 x3 ]: Z<div id="Layer2" style="position:absolute; left:500px; top:0px; width:220px; height:220px; z-index:1">
    2 t4 w8 A  w* V- q. L; ?内容 9 n7 u, ?. h- b' p8 ^
    </div></div>
    0 S& V% n; O- O& E/ e5 c2 C
    + p! V* f, k6 h8 c3 `Flash代码以及背景透明
    * V+ c7 ?% g8 a$ z<object classid="clsid27CDB6E-AE6D-11cf-96B8-444553540000" codebase="http://download.macromedia.com/pub/shockwave/cabs/flash/swflash.cab#version=6,0,29,0" width="200" height="200">
    : h7 \) @: S& n<param name="movie" value="文件">
    , Z: L! |8 d6 i% Y<param name="quality" value="high"> 2 @' x! n1 r5 C* @+ V$ D
    <param name="wmode" value="transparent"> 5 Q. ?  V& `( R% M
    <embed src="images/fish.swf" quality="high" pluginspage="http://www.macromedia.com/go/getflashplayer" type="application/x-shockwave-flash" width="220" height="220"></embed></object>
    常上飞翔,梦想飞扬!经贸是我家,建设靠大家~ 人们都说:不在大学论坛里灌过水的大学都像是没读过大学~
    您需要登录后才可以回帖 登录 | 免费注册

    本版积分规则

    QQ|版主考核中心|『经贸在线』 ( 桂ICP备15001539号-2  

    GMT+8, 2025-6-24 07:46

    Powered by Discuz! X3.2

    © 2001-2013 Comsenz Inc.

    快速回复 返回顶部 返回列表